Subject: Re: [Qemu-devel] [PATCH v3 09/10] tcg: Clean up direct block chaining safety checks
Date: Tue, 19 Apr 2016 12:37:03 +0100	[thread overview]
Message-ID: <878u09x21s.fsf@linaro.org> (raw)
In-Reply-To: <1460324732-30330-10-git-send-email-sergey.fedorov@linaro.org>


Sergey Fedorov <sergey.fedorov@linaro.org> writes:

> From: Sergey Fedorov <serge.fdrv@gmail.com>
>
> We don't take care of direct jumps when address mapping changes. Thus we
> must be sure to generate direct jumps so that they always keep valid
> even if address mapping changes. However we only allow to execute a TB
> if it was generated from the pages which match with current mapping.
>
> Document in comments in the translation code the reason for these checks
> on a destination PC.
>
> Some targets with variable length instructions allow TB to straddle a
> page boundary. However, we make sure that both TB pages match the
> current address mapping when looking up TBs. So it is safe to do direct
> jumps into both pages. Correct the checks for those targets.
>
> Given that, we can safely patch a TB which spans two pages. Remove the
> unnecessary check in cpu_exec() and allow such TBs to be patched.
>

> diff --git a/cpu-exec.c b/cpu-exec.c
> index bbfcbfb54385..065cc9159477 100644
> --- a/cpu-exec.c
> +++ b/cpu-exec.c
> @@ -508,11 +508,8 @@ int cpu_exec(CPUState *cpu)
>                      next_tb = 0;
>                      tcg_ctx.tb_ctx.tb_invalidated_flag = 0;
>                  }
> -                /* see if we can patch the calling TB. When the TB
> -                   spans two pages, we cannot safely do a direct
> -                   jump. */
> -                if (next_tb != 0 && tb->page_addr[1] == -1
> -                    && !qemu_loglevel_mask(CPU_LOG_TB_NOCHAIN)) {
> +                /* See if we can patch the calling TB. */
> +                if (next_tb != 0 && !qemu_loglevel_mask(CPU_LOG_TB_NOCHAIN)) {
>                      tb_add_jump((TranslationBlock *)(next_tb & ~TB_EXIT_MASK),
>                                  next_tb & TB_EXIT_MASK, tb);
>                  }

We've already discussed on IRC the confusion of next_tb ;-)
